High Wind Watch
Issued: 11:17 PM Mar. 13, 2026 – National Weather Service
...HIGH WIND WATCH REMAINS IN EFFECT FROM LATE SATURDAY NIGHT THROUGH SUNDAY EVENING... * WHAT...North winds 30 to 40 mph with gusts up to 60 mph possible. * WHERE...Portions of east central and southeast Colorado including El Paso, Pueblo, Las Animas, Crowley, Otero, Kiowa, Bent, Prowers and Baca Counties. * WHEN...From late Saturday night through Sunday evening. * IMPACTS...Damaging winds could blow down trees and power lines. Power outages are possible. Travel could be difficult, especially for high profile vehicles.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S...Areas of blowing dust could reduce visibility to under a mile at times. Be especially careful near recently plowed land or locations with disturbed soils. Visiblities can change rapidly over short distances. P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S... Monitor the latest forecasts and warnings for updates. &&
Red Flag Warning
Issued: 6:44 PM Mar. 13, 2026 – National Weather Service
...RED FLAG WARNING REMAINS IN EFFECT UNTIL 8 PM MDT THIS EVENING FOR GUSTY WINDS AND LOW RELATIVE HUMIDITY FOR FIRE WEATHER ZONES 220, 222, 224, 225, 226, 227, 228, 229, 230, 231, 232, AND 233... ...RED FLAG WARNING REMAINS IN EFFECT FROM 11 AM TO 10 PM MDT SATURDAY FOR GUSTY WINDS AND LOW RELATIVE HUMIDITY FOR FIRE WEATHER ZONES 220, 222, 224, 225, 226, 227, 228, 229, 230, 231, 232, AND 233... * AFFECTED AREA...Fire Weather Zones 220, 222, 224, 225, 226, 227, 228, 229, 230, 231, 232 and 233. * WINDS...For today, West winds 15 to 20 mph with gusts to 35 mph. For Saturday, West 25 to 30 mph with gusts up to 55 mph. * RELATIVE HUMIDITY...As low as 10 percent. * IMPACTS...Extreme fire danger is expected. Fires could uncontrollably spread and be very destructive. P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S... A Red Flag Warning means that critical fire weather conditions are either occurring now, or will shortly. A combination of strong winds, low relative humidity, and warm temperatures can contribute to extreme fire behavior. &&
